首页前端开发CSScss如何实现3d渲染

css如何实现3d渲染

时间2023-11-27 05:03:02发布访客分类CSS浏览500
导读:在现代Web设计中,为网页添加3D效果已经成为了一个重要的趋势。而CSS的3D属性就是实现这种效果的技术基石。让我们来看看如何利用CSS实现3D渲染。/* 定义3D场景 */.scene { position: relative;...

在现代Web设计中,为网页添加3D效果已经成为了一个重要的趋势。而CSS的3D属性就是实现这种效果的技术基石。让我们来看看如何利用CSS实现3D渲染。

/* 定义3D场景 */.scene {
        position: relative;
        perspective: 1000px;
     /* 视角距离 */    transform-style: preserve-3d;
 /* 保存3D效果 */}
/* 定义3D元素 */.box {
        position: absolute;
        background: #ccc;
        width: 200px;
        height: 200px;
        transform-style: preserve-3d;
     /* 保存3D效果 */    transition: all 0.5s;
 /* 移动动画 */}
/* 转动3D元素 */.box:hover {
        transform: rotateX(60deg) rotateY(60deg);
 /* 绕X、Y轴旋转60度 */}
/* 在3D元素内添加内容 */.box p {
        position: absolute;
        top: 50%;
        left: 50%;
        transform: translate(-50%, -50%) rotateZ(-45deg);
 /* 让文字倾斜 */}
    

这段CSS代码实现了一个3D场景并在其中添加了一个3D元素。通过:hover事件,可以制作转动的效果,可以看到这个元素能自由移动和旋转。我们可以通过CSS的美学能力来调整元素的颜色、透明度和其他方面来更好地渲染3D元素。总之,CSS的3D功能是网页设计中必不可少的拓展技术之一。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: css如何实现3d渲染
本文地址: https://pptw.com/jishu/557106.html
css3 html5登录表单 css3 html5权威指南

游客 回复需填写必要信息